WebWe have x 3 + 1 = (x + 1) (x 2 − x + 1). Now, ( x + 1 ) x 3 + 1 = x + 1 ( x + 1 ) ( x 2 − x + 1 ) = ( x 2 − x + 1 ) . So when x 3 + 1 is divided by ( x + 1 ) then the quotient be x 2 − x + 1 …

WebDivide x^{3}+5x^{2}+3x-1 by x+1 to get x^{2}+4x-1. Solve the equation where the result equals to 0. x=\frac{-4±\sqrt{4^{2}-4\times 1\left(-1\right)}}{2} All equations of the form ax^{2}+bx+c=0 can be solved using the quadratic formula: \frac{-b±\sqrt{b^{2}-4ac}}{2a}. Substitute 1 for a, 4 for b, and -1 for c in the quadratic formula.
